绊(絆)bàn(ban4)
The character 绊 (bàn) primarily means 'to trip' or 'to stumble,' often used in contexts where someone is hindered or obstructed physically or metaphorically. It can also refer to the concept of being shackled or fettered, implying a limitation or restriction.

Quick Contrast
绊 (bàn) vs 拖 (tuō) — use 绊 when referring specifically to tripping or stumbling, while 拖 implies dragging or pulling something along.

Usage Notes
Be cautious not to confuse 绊 with similar sounding words that have different meanings; for example, the word '扮' (bàn) means to dress up, which is unrelated. This word is generally informal and can be used in everyday conversations about physical stumbles or metaphorically when discussing obstacles in life.

她绊了一下摔倒了,手掌和膝盖都蹭破了。
tā bàn le yī xià shuāi dǎo le, , shǒu zhǎng hé xī gài dū cèng pò。
She stumbled and fell, scraping her palms and knees.
3
我只是绊了一下,周围就变成了一片黑暗。
wǒ zhī shì bàn le yī xià, , zhōu wéi jiù biàn chéng le yī piàn hēi。
I make it into the darkness with only one stumble.
4
他在不平的地上绊了一跤,摔了个嘴啃地.
tā zài bù píng de dì shàng bàn le yī jiāo, , shuāi le gè zuǐ kěn.
He stumbled on the uneven ground and fell flat on his face.
5
我绊了一下,伤到了脚。
wǒ bàn le yī xià, , shāng dào le。
I tripped up and hurt my foot.
6
有人伸出一条腿,把我绊倒了.
yǒu rén shēn chū yī tiáo tuǐ, , bǎ wǒ bàn dǎo.
Someone stuck a leg out and tripped me up.
7
他们吹口哨挑逗我,我窘迫之下绊了一跤。
tā mén chuī kǒu shào tiāo dòu wǒ, , wǒ jiǒng pò zhī xià bàn le yī。
They wolf-whistled at me, and I was so embarrassed I tripped up.
8
他绊倒在地,膝盖上蹭破了皮。
tā bàn dǎo zài dì, , xī gài shàng cèng pò le。
He had stumbled down and torn the skin from his knees.
9
他绊了一下,撞翻了椅子.
tā bàn le yī xià, , zhuàng fān le yǐ.
He stumbled and overthrew the chair.

Word Family of 绊
Words Containing This Character8
绊倒to trip絆倒
绊bànto trip絆
羁绊trammels羈絆
绊脚石obstacle絆腳石
牵绊to bind牽絆
磕磕绊绊bumpy (of a road)磕磕絆絆
绊住to entangle絆住
绊脚to stumble over sth絆腳
